logo

边缘计算实战指南:从理论到落地的系统性课程设计

作者:暴富20212025.10.10 16:17浏览量:1

简介:本文深入探讨边缘计算课程的核心内容,从基础理论到实践应用,为开发者提供系统化学习路径,助力企业高效部署边缘计算解决方案。

一、边缘计算课程的核心价值与行业需求

1.1 边缘计算的技术定位与市场趋势

边缘计算通过将数据处理能力下沉至网络边缘节点,实现了低延迟(通常<20ms)、高带宽(支持4K/8K视频流)和隐私保护(数据本地化处理)的核心优势。根据IDC预测,2025年全球边缘计算市场规模将突破2500亿美元,年复合增长率达34.1%。这一增长主要由工业物联网(IIoT)、自动驾驶、智慧城市等场景驱动,例如特斯拉FSD自动驾驶系统通过边缘计算实现每秒36万亿次运算的实时决策。

1.2 开发者能力缺口与企业转型痛点

当前企业面临三大挑战:其一,传统云计算架构无法满足实时性要求(如工业机械臂控制需<10ms响应);其二,海量设备产生的数据传输成本高昂(单台智能摄像头日均产生30GB数据);其三,隐私法规(如GDPR)要求数据本地化处理。开发者需要掌握边缘计算框架(如KubeEdge、EdgeX Foundry)、轻量化AI模型部署(TensorFlow Lite)、以及边缘设备管理(如AWS IoT Greengrass)等核心技能。

二、边缘计算课程体系设计

2.1 基础理论模块

  • 分布式系统原理:重点讲解CAP定理在边缘场景的适应性,例如在工厂环境中如何平衡一致性(设备状态同步)与可用性(断网持续运行)。
  • 网络通信协议:对比MQTT(轻量级发布/订阅)、CoAP(受限应用协议)和HTTP/3(QUIC传输)在边缘设备中的适用场景。
  • 资源约束优化:通过案例分析(如树莓派4B运行YOLOv5s模型)讲解内存占用从1.2GB优化至300MB的技术路径。

2.2 核心开发技能

2.2.1 边缘AI模型开发

  1. # TensorFlow Lite模型量化示例
  2. import tensorflow as tf
  3. converter = tf.lite.TFLiteConverter.from_saved_model('mobilenet_v2')
  4. converter.optimizations = [tf.lite.Optimize.DEFAULT]
  5. quantized_model = converter.convert()
  6. with open('quantized_model.tflite', 'wb') as f:
  7. f.write(quantized_model)

通过8位量化技术,模型体积可缩小75%,推理速度提升2-3倍,特别适合NVIDIA Jetson等边缘设备。

2.2.2 边缘框架实践

  • KubeEdge架构解析:讲解CloudCore与EdgeCore的通信机制,以及如何通过EdgeSite实现断网自治。
  • EdgeX Foundry设备服务开发:以Modbus协议设备接入为例,演示从设备发现到数据上云的完整流程。

2.3 安全与运维体系

  • 零信任架构实施:通过SPIFFE身份认证和SPIRE证书管理,实现边缘节点间的双向TLS认证。
  • 异常检测算法:基于LSTM神经网络构建设备行为基线,实时识别流量异常(如某智能电表数据突变检测)。

三、典型应用场景与实战案例

3.1 智能制造场景

某汽车工厂通过边缘计算实现:

  • 焊接机器人视觉引导系统:在产线部署NVIDIA Jetson AGX Xavier,实现<5ms的焊缝定位
  • 预测性维护:通过边缘节点采集振动数据,使用LSTM模型预测设备故障(准确率92%)
  • 质量控制:在冲压机旁部署边缘AI,实时检测零件缺陷(检测速度120件/分钟)

3.2 智慧城市实践

上海某区部署的边缘计算路灯控制系统:

  • 光照传感器数据在边缘节点本地处理,根据车流量动态调节亮度(节能40%)
  • 视频流在边缘进行车牌识别,仅将违规数据上传至云端
  • 设备故障自诊断,通过边缘AI识别灯杆倾斜(检测精度0.1°)

四、课程实施建议

4.1 硬件实验平台配置

推荐组合:

  • 开发板:NVIDIA Jetson Xavier NX(6核ARM CPU + 384核GPU)
  • 传感器套件:包含温湿度、加速度、摄像头模块
  • 网关设备:支持5G/Wi-Fi 6的双模工业网关

4.2 项目制学习路径

  1. 基础阶段:完成LED灯控制、温湿度数据采集等入门实验
  2. 进阶阶段:实现人脸识别门禁系统(部署MobileNet SSD模型)
  3. 综合阶段:开发工业质检系统,集成多传感器数据融合与缺陷分类

4.3 持续学习资源

  • 官方文档:EdgeX Foundry GitHub仓库、KubeEdge用户手册
  • 社区支持:LF Edge基金会技术论坛、Stack Overflow边缘计算标签
  • 认证体系:Linux Foundation边缘计算专家认证(LFCE)

五、未来技术演进方向

5.1 边缘原生(Edge-Native)架构

Gartner预测到2025年,60%的边缘计算部署将采用边缘原生设计。关键特征包括:

  • 容器化部署:支持K3s、MicroK8s等轻量级Kubernetes发行版
  • 服务网格:通过Linkerd或Istio实现边缘服务间的安全通信
  • 无服务器计算:AWS Lambda@Edge等函数即服务模式

5.2 边缘智能融合

  • 神经形态计算:Intel Loihi芯片在边缘实现类脑计算
  • 联邦学习:在保护数据隐私的前提下完成模型训练(如医疗影像分析)
  • 数字孪生:通过边缘计算实现物理设备的实时数字映射

本课程通过理论讲解、代码实践、案例分析的三维教学体系,帮助开发者掌握边缘计算从设备层到应用层的全栈能力。建议学习者按照”基础概念→开发工具→项目实战→优化部署”的路径循序渐进,最终具备独立设计并实现边缘计算解决方案的能力。对于企业用户,可结合具体业务场景(如零售门店的客流分析、物流仓库的AGV调度)开展定制化培训,实现技术投入与业务价值的直接挂钩。

相关文章推荐

发表评论

活动